International. The enerTIC platform will hold in Barcelona on October 27 the forum "IoT: Energy Efficiency & Sustainability" in which it will analyze how the Internet of Things improves energy efficiency and sustainability.
EnerTIC recalls that "digital transformation reaches our entire environment" and that the Internet of Things is its maximum exponent. "Within 10 years we will have 50 billion connected objects that will play a fundamental role in the strategy of improving energy efficiency and sustainability in all areas of our society."
In this sense, the connectivity and sensorization of the objects "that surround us will mean a revolution in the way in which we obtain information and optimize the management of Smart Cities, Indrustry 4.0, Smart Grids and Smart Vehicles. To manage this network of millions of connected objects, it will be necessary to optimize the energy efficiency of the equipment and the methods of transmission, storage and analysis of the data generated."
To this end, specific transmission technologies are emerging and more efficient Smart Data Centers are being developed. "The data obtained through IoT will help us monitor and improve the energy cat and increase sustainability through the digitalization of energy or Smart Energy."
Integrators, consultants and facility management companies will be responsible for designing complete solutions that offer a simple and personalized management to each case of IoT infrastructures. And the proliferation of technology will enable the creation of new business models for both data collection and application.
